I really enjoy my monitors, and fully appreciate how much work any large varanid is!
They currantly have two main enclosures. One inside is 8 ft long, and approx 4 ft wide(inside measurement something like 3.5 ft+ due to me rebuilding the front door/wall). The outside enclosure is 8ft x 8ft, 6 ft tall. When weather is good, they get to enjoy the outside(when I'm home, for security reasons).
